Step 1: Starting with the Spec

Captures what you are looking to build: it’s design and implementation. Sometimes I work with an AI to go deep on the definition up front, and other times I stay shallower and flush out the spec as I add more features.

Gemini Diffusion!

I love a good zig and zag. We used to be in a world where image generation used diffusion techniques (from noise), and text used autoregresion (next token). ChatGPT added 4o image generation that went the other way and used autoregression …

% parade list openai

I've been enjoying building simple tools writing a spec and having them generated.

`parade` uses Ink and Vercel's AI SDK to let me explore model names from various providers (because I am using the openai:gpt-4o type URI format in other tools).
